Introduction: Inventory card This procedure presents the full process to be followed with A.M.A.S.I.S for managing the inventory card.

• Each reference has one or several inventory cards according to the number of storage locations (the number of stores of a Part Number is indicated on the reference card), that will used as information by the storekeeper and the logistician.

• Each card includes, for the related store, information in quantity (in stock, in transfer, ordered) and in

value (unit and total value of stock in WAPP, last purchase price) store position, and data necessary for provisioning release (min., max. stock, order point).

• Available resources will be the synthesis of the information mainly supplied by the inventory cards for

a same Part Number and its alternates.

Process: Inventory card The origin of the creation of an inventory card can be:

� Manual creation � Manual from a Manufacturer reference � Automatic creation further to Receipt form � Automatic creation further to a Removal form (Operation form) � Automatic creation further to a Purchase order � Automatic creation further to a Rental order

The creation, when not manually made by the first movement in the corresponding store, and all the default values come from the Part Number and document. The store location only is left at « SP » (store position) and shall be carefully introduced for storage stores.

STK-ST-P3 Stock value

All the data concerning stock status are introduced here, as well as:

- store value: Total value of stored material for rotable, except material of type 4 (consumable reparable) which quantity under repair or pending quantity is also taken into account.

- unit purchase price: Last purchase price recorded in AMASIS in the basic currency. Field filled in either manually in change mode, or automatically when introducing an order or an invoice. If this field is not introduced when inventory card is changed, the price will correspond to the highest price of supplier catalog of reference card.

- WAPP:

Weighted Average Purchase Price in the basic currency. Unit value calculated by AMASIS. It corresponds to actual value of the store divided by quantity in stock. Any consumable issued from the store will have WAPP value, contrary to rotable which has the same unit price as the one stated on its accounting sheet (‘last accounting value’).

STK-ST-P4 Work with Shelf Time Some parts have a shelf limit. Thus, a shelf time is defined. Two shelf times by inventory card can be defined:

- Shelf Time 1 Max. length on shelf (in months) as specified on P/C reference card

Shelf time 1 is systematically linked to a work code (test, calibration, check, inspection, etc).

Shelf-time 1 is automatically written down on any inventory linked to P/N:

- Shelf Time 2 Max. length of storage specific to inventory card and to limits linked to storage area.

Shelf times of consumables are indicated for information only and do not appear on Task schedule. However, for rotable, shelf time start date must be initialized in calendar ageing tab of each Equipment card linked to P/N to emphasize limit at Task schedule level.

Receipt form parameter settings option can be used to introduce shelf time date on equipment receipt. Otherwise, storage date is by default receipt date.

STK-ST-P5 Stock provisioning levels

This tab serves to define the stock levels that will trigger ordering point alerts. There are three determining thresholds:

- Minimum stock: Point below which actual inventory shall not be. Thus, replenishment lead-time would impede answering current consumption needs or remaining quantity would impede supplying parts qualified as ‘No go’.

- Ordering point: Point from which an order is triggered, delivery lead-time allowing a delivery before

inventory shortage ( )

- Maximum stock: point above which there is an excess inventory. If these three points are at 0, AMASIS considers that these thresholds are not managed. The settings of these values are described in Automatic Provisioning User’s manual.

STK-ST-P10 Delete inventory card To be able to delete an inventory card, this one must have no quantity known and no movement history in the concerned store.

To delete an inventory card, click «Delete » on the right tool bar.
